Opposite angles of an inscribed quadrilateral are supplementary.
X = 180° -Q
X = 180° -73° = 107°
The value of the algebraic expressions when x = 5 are:
a) x² = <em>25</em>
<em>b) </em>(x + 3)² = <em>64</em>
We are given that x = 5.
<em>Required:</em>
Find the value of a.) x² and b.) (x + 3)²
To find the value of each algebraic expression when x = 5, substitute the value of x.
<em>Thus:</em>
a.) x²
x² = (5)²
x² = <em>25</em>
<em />
b.) (x + 3)²
(x + 3)² = (5 + 3)²
(x + 3)² = (8)²
(x + 3)² = <em>64</em>
Therefore, the value of the algebraic expressions when x = 5 are:
a) x² = <em>25</em>
<em>b) </em>(x + 3)² = <em>64</em>
